Campaigns Intern, Netherlands (Dutch-speaking)

Last updated: February 19, 2026 6:29 pm
By GEOPOLIST | Istanbul Center for Geopolitics Published February 19, 2026 6 Min Read
Share
SHARE
  • Contract
  • Brussels, Belgium
  • Posted 2 months ago
ONE

ONE


Position description

ONE is a global, nonpartisan organization fighting for a more just world by demanding the investments needed to create economic opportunities and healthier lives in Africa. We do this by deploying trusted and dynamic advocacy that leverages hard-hitting data, credible grassroots activism, creative political engagement, and strategic partnerships. We use all this to influence decision-makers to take action and tackle the world’s biggest challenges. Read more atwww.one.org.

ABOUT THE OPPORTUNITY

Employees of ONE work in a collaborative and creative environment towards reaching a common goal of ending extreme poverty and preventable disease. When you work for ONE, you will receive excellent benefits along with the opportunity to be part of an international organization and to contribute to our mission.

The Campaigns Intern will support the Netherlands Youth Ambassador and Campaign project team, helping them to deliver an impactful and diverse program in the Netherlands. ONE Youth Ambassadors are a dedicated team of volunteers who electrify our campaigns across Europe. They engage decision makers, work with the media, and encourage the public to sign ONE petitions through online activity and local events.

The full-time internship will be either 6 or 12 months in duration,starting at the beginning of March 2026(depending on the availability of the intern). This internship is based in our Brussels office. Following the COVID-19 situation, we have become more flexible, and colleagues are able to work remotely (from home). We do aim to work at our office on Tuesdays and Thursdays. We might foresee some (international) travel in this 6- or 12-month internship.

In this role, you will work with campaigners across Europe, as well as our 30 Youth Ambassadors in the Netherlands. The ideal candidate would have some knowledge of campaigning, media, development, and our core policy issues, which include development cooperation and health. The Campaigns Intern will report to and work daily with the Senior Campaigns Coordinator, the Netherlands.

IN THIS ROLE, YOU WILL

      • Support the team to deliver successful campaigns and an active and engaged Youth Ambassador programme;
      • Assist with campaigns, policy, advocacy, and action planning;
      • Identify opportunities and support the logistical and creative planning of events and communications;
      • Sometimes speak to members of Parliament, the public or other organisations about ONE;
      • Provide translations and support content creation for our social media channels;
      • Support with putting our message forward in Dutch media;
      • Provide general administrative and database support as required;
      •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

      • Passion for creating change is most important, ideally with experience of campaigning;
      • Attention to detail, with excellent office skills;
      • Ability to work independently (essential) and to be pro-active;
      •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, keeping calm under pressure and solution focused;
      • Bring creativity and have bold campaign ideas;
      • Ability to work together effectively with people from various cultural backgrounds;
      • Proven interest in international development and Africa;
      • Good communication skills and excellent command of both Dutch and English (written and spoken);
      • Ability to consistently apply good judgment and make good and responsible decisions;
      • Ability to always maintain the highest degree of confidentiality regarding all aspects of work.

INTERESTED? LET’S CHAT

If you are ready to contribute to creating economic opportunities and healthier lives in Africa, please submit a CV inEnglishand a cover letter inDutch(explaining why you are the best fit for the position).Applications will be reviewed on a rolling basis; we will conclude the search once we have identified a suitable candidate. Candidates that do not provide cover letters in Dutch will not be considered.

The internship is remunerated 1,077 euros net + 50 euros telework benefit.
